About This Call

The City of Auburn invites sculptors to submit applications for Auburn's Downtown Sculpture Gallery, a public art exhibition showcasing 11+ sculptures throughout its historic downtown. The works selected will be on loan to the City for twelve months (September 2026 – September 2027) and can be available for sale during that time. Each selected artist will receive a $1,000 stipend. At the conclusion of the exhibition, a sculpture from the exhibition may be purchased for inclusion in the City of Auburn's permanent collection with a purchase budget of $10,000.

Eligibility is limited to sculptors or artist teams living or working in the Pacific Northwest (Washington, Oregon, Idaho, California, and Montana). Artists are required to deliver their artwork in person to Auburn, Washington. Sculptural works must be three-dimensional, suitable for outdoor display, made of durable materials, and able to withstand the elements as well as interaction with pedestrians and the general public. Sculptures must not exceed 300 pounds and must be available for the full loan period of September 14, 2026 - September 17, 2027. Applicants may submit up to ten sculptures for consideration, with one image per artwork (detail images combined into one JPEG). Existing sculptures as well as artwork proposals are accepted; proposals can be submitted as sketches or illustrations combined into one JPEG with examples of other work demonstrating artistry, proficiency, and finish quality.

Artwork will be located throughout Auburn's downtown with locations assigned by City staff. Sculptures can be welded onto or bolted onto a steel plate attached to a concrete pedestal. The artist is responsible for transportation and installation of the artwork with some city assistance. The City of Auburn will provide insurance for the sculpture while on display, but not for damage incurred during installation and/or deinstallation.
